Chronicle of an Irish Exhibition at the United Nations features bonds with Cuban culture and history.

New York, 28 February 2018. In the corridors of the United Nations, peculiar and beautiful exhibitions of nations across the globe can be found every day. In this case "The Irish in Latin America", by the Republic of Ireland, will be on display until 2 March. This touring exhibition illustrates the fascinating story of adventurers, soldiers, missionaries and simple Irish immigrants who shaped the culture and politics of Latin America.

Press Release: Cuba is re-elected as Vice-Chair of the United Nations Decolonization Committee.

New York, 23 February 2018. At the first meeting of the year 2018, held on 22 February, the Permanent Representative of Cuba to the United Nations, Ambassador Anayansi Rodríguez Camejo, was re-elected as Vice-Chairperson of the "Special Committee on the Situation with regard to the Implementation of the Declaration on the Granting of Independence to Colonial Countries and Peoples", known as the United Nations Decolonization Committee.

Press Release: Permanent Representative of Cuba to the United Nations greets the President of the Palestinian National Authority.

New York, February 22, 2018. The Permanent Representative of Cuba to the United Nations, Ambassador Anayansi Rodríguez Camejo, had a brief meeting on February 20 with Mahmoud Abbas, President of the State of Palestine and of the Palestinian National Authority, who traveled to New York to participate in the Security Council briefing on the situation in the Middle East, including the Palestinian question.
